living in jacksonville florida or orange county california?

Reese Peterson
Posted

Hi everyone!

Have you lived in both Jacksonville FL and Orange County? I am currently living in orange county. the living expense in Orange County is pretty high so I am wondering if I should move to Jacksonville FL. i've heard that's pretty affordable to live in JAX and the unemployment rate is low, however the climate is not as good as California and overall pay is lower in JAX. if you have lived in both places, what do you like and dislike about Orange County California and Jacksonville FL?

@Reese Peterson Hello Reese, I reside in Jacksonville Fl currently and happen to be from Irvine California and San Diego prior to moving here.

There are definitely pros about the weather you can’t beat in Southern California however when you look at overall cost of living and high performing / growing economy I would highly suggest looking into Jacksonville.

Outside of that, Jacksonville is a great area for REI with so much room for growth while still being more affordable than a lot of other markets in the US.
